Nutritional state – a survival kit for brooding pipefish fathers
A parent’s nutritional state may influence its ability to provide care to offspring and ability to handle infections. In the broad-nosed pipefish, Syngnathus typhle, males care for their offspring by brooding the developing embryos in a brood pouch, providing nutrients and oxygen, resembling a pregnancy. متن کاملThe Nutritional Impacts of European Contact on the Omaha: A Continuing Legacy
For the majority ofNative American tribes on the Great Plains, contact with Euro-Americans resulted in a number of changes in their lifeways. For the Omaha tribe, the introduction ofboth the horse and firearms meant a diversification in nutritional strategies and a florescence in their culture.
